“…The experimental data presented in the research performed by Oliveira et al 30) were estimated using Brookfield LVTD viscometer at 1 550°C. Results of the present work for the CaO-Al 2 O 3 system are in a good agreement with the data reported by Oliveira et al 30) Comparison of the experimental data of the present work using two viscosity measurement techniques with the data of Oliveira et al 30) reveals that the obtained results for the vibrating (oscillating) finger viscometer is more compatible with the data reported by Oliveira et al 30) However, there are considerable differences between the experimental results of the present work and the calculated data presented by Wu et al 32,33) Moreover, the obtained viscosity values for CaO-SiO 2 system have been compared with both the rotation cup viscometer results reported by Urbain et al 31) in the temperature range of 1 552 to 1 903°C and with the viscosity data obtained by simulations reported by Wu et al 32,33) Surprisingly, computed results of Wu et al 32,33) depict a better agreement with the present research as compared to the experimentally obtained values of Urbain et al 31) Fig. 5.…”

“…However, because of the electric charge of Al 3+ , charge compensation of Al 3+ in the tetrahedral coordination is necessary, which can be achieved by either alkali‐ or alkaline‐earth metals by forming [Na(AlO 4 )] 4– or [(1/2Ca)(AlO 4 )] 4– tetrahedra as diagrammed in Figure . Research has revealed that the aluminate network becomes more complex with increasing Al 2 O 3 content, and for a given Al 2 O 3 content in different systems, both the Al‐O structural disorder and the polymerization degree of the network structure increase as the metal cations become more electronegative . In other words, for a given Al 2 O 3 content, the effects of the components on stabilizing the Al‐O network are sequenced as K 2 O > Na 2 O > CaO > MgO, and the polymerization degree of the structure in different systems follows the order K 2 O‐Al 2 O 3 < Na 2 O‐Al 2 O 3 < CaO‐Al 2 O 3 < MgO‐Al 2 O 3 .…”
